Viburnum erubescens, commonly known as the blush viburnum, is a deciduous shrub or small tree belonging to the Adoxaceae family. It is native to the mountainous regions of the Himalayas, China, and parts of Southeast Asia, where it thrives in forest understories and along watercourses.

This shrub requires fertile, humus-rich, and well-drained soil to flourish. It prefers neutral to slightly acidic conditions and performs best when soil moisture is consistent throughout the growing season, mimicking its natural temperate forest environment.

For optimal growth, Viburnum erubescens should be placed in a location that receives partial shade to full sun. It is essential to provide protection from drying winds, which can damage the foliage and cause premature leaf drop during dry summer periods.

Botanically, the species is distinguished by its opposite, dentate leaves and pendulous clusters of white or pinkish flowers. Following pollination, the plant produces elliptical, bright red fruits that provide significant visual interest during the autumn months.

In terms of agricultural and horticultural use, this species is primarily valued for its ornamental appeal in gardens and public landscapes. It is frequently employed in woodland plantings or as a specimen shrub, adding texture and color to diverse planting schemes.

Main diseases and pests

Viburnum erubescens can be susceptible to common viburnum pests, such as the viburnum leaf beetle, which feeds on the foliage. Early detection and treatment with appropriate contact or systemic insecticides are recommended to prevent significant defoliation.

Powdery mildew represents the most prevalent fungal disease, particularly when plants are grown in overcrowded conditions with poor airflow. Maintaining proper spacing and pruning for aeration helps manage the humidity levels around the foliage.

Leaf spot diseases may occur in particularly humid or wet climates, leading to necrotic lesions on the leaves. Sanitation measures, such as removing and destroying fallen infected leaves, are vital to breaking the disease cycle within the garden environment.

Aphids are typical pests that congregate on tender new growth, causing curling and stunted development. Providing a habitat for beneficial predatory insects like ladybirds can often help control minor infestations naturally without the need for intensive chemical applications.

Root system health is critical, as waterlogged conditions can lead to root rot. Ensuring that the planting site has excellent drainage and avoiding soil compaction are fundamental aspects of successfully maintaining this shrub over the long term.
